摘要
In this paper, for the defects which the basic genetic algorithm can get local optimum easily and converge slowly, the genetic algorithm is improved by constructing a suitable fitness function and improving genetic operators. Meanwhile, the improved genetic algorithm is applied to select optimal access network in integrated heterogeneous wireless networks. According to Quality of Service (QoS) requirements of different business types, compared with combined the analytic hierarchy process (AHP) and the technique for order preference by similarity to an ideal solution (TOPSIS) and the basic genetic algorithm, the simulation results indicate that the improved genetic algorithm can find a network with higher fitness and better meet different QoS.
